    < Back Days for Girls Days for Girls Canada Society is a registered Canadian not for profit and is a Country Affiliate with Days for Girls International. Volunteers across Canada mobilize to increase access to menstrual products and vital health information for women and girls around the world. Days for Girls Canada Society is a registered Canadian not for profit and is a Country Affiliate with Days for Girls International. Volunteers across Canada mobilize to increase access to menstrual products and vital health information for women and girls around the world. In October, John Lendein was able to add 350 kits for the Bettesu school, and 50 special kits for any woman that delivers a baby in the clinic to another shipment that was being sent to Bettesu Liberia.     This Week At Bethel November 7, 2025 This Sunday Church Family News Announcements Community News Calendar Bulletin Archive This Sunday We continue our sermon series, The Gospel for Everyone, exploring the Romans Road through Paul’s letter to the Romans. Each week we will reflect on a different "signpost" that helps us share the good news and journey the road together to Jesus. This week, we will look at how God’s gift of freedom and forgiveness changes the direction and quality of our lives. We’ll look at the signpost in Romans 6:23: “For the wages of sin is death, but the gift of God is eternal life in Christ Jesus our Lord.” Not only does Paul’s reminder describe the true consequences of sin in our hearts, but it also guides us along the path to new life in Christ. *For resources from The Gospel for Everyone series, visit discovebethel.com/resources Our Sunday Offerings: BETHEL MINISTRIES AND MISSION : The ministries and programs of Bethel DUNAMIS FELLOWSHIP CANADA: is on a mission to mobilize, equip and deploy Spirit-empowered witnesses for Jesus Christ to take part in fulfilling the great commission. Dunamis offers courses and conferences on the person and work of the Holy Spirit based on Christ-centered, biblical teaching from a Reformed perspective and anchored in practical,experiential learning.
